In the field of aerospace engineering, the term interstage shielding is crucial for ensuring the safety and efficiency of multi-stage rockets. This concept refers to the protective measures implemented between different stages of a rocket during its ascent through the atmosphere. The primary purpose of interstage shielding is to prevent the transfer of heat and pressure from one stage to another, which could potentially lead to catastrophic failures. As rockets ascend, they encounter varying atmospheric conditions that can cause significant thermal and mechanical stresses. Without adequate interstage shielding, these stresses could compromise the integrity of the rocket's structure and jeopardize the mission.One of the key challenges in designing effective interstage shielding is balancing weight and performance. Engineers must select materials that are both lightweight and capable of withstanding extreme temperatures. Commonly used materials include ablative composites and specialized metals that can dissipate heat effectively. The design of the shielding must also account for the rocket's trajectory and the specific environmental conditions it will face during launch and flight.Moreover, interstage shielding plays a vital role in the overall aerodynamics of the rocket. A well-designed shielding system can reduce drag and improve the rocket's performance, allowing it to reach higher altitudes and speeds. This is particularly important in missions where payload capacity is critical, such as satellite launches or crewed spaceflights.In addition to thermal protection, interstage shielding also serves as a structural component that helps maintain the alignment of the rocket stages during flight. Misalignment can lead to instability, which may result in loss of control. Therefore, engineers must consider the mechanical properties of the shielding materials to ensure that they provide adequate support while also fulfilling their protective roles.The importance of interstage shielding was highlighted during several historic space missions. For instance, during the Apollo program, engineers faced significant challenges related to heat management between stages. The successful implementation of interstage shielding allowed the Apollo spacecraft to safely travel to the Moon and return to Earth, showcasing the critical role that this technology plays in space exploration.As we look towards the future of space travel, the development of advanced interstage shielding technologies will be essential. With the rise of commercial spaceflight and plans for missions to Mars and beyond, engineers are continuously researching new materials and designs to enhance the effectiveness of shielding systems. Innovations such as nanomaterials and adaptive shielding concepts are on the horizon, promising to revolutionize how we approach rocket design.In conclusion, understanding the significance of interstage shielding is essential for anyone involved in aerospace engineering. It encompasses not only the technical aspects of material selection and design but also the broader implications for mission success and safety. As we continue to push the boundaries of space exploration, the evolution of interstage shielding will undoubtedly play a pivotal role in shaping the future of our journeys beyond Earth.
